Romanian President Calls for Referendum To Make Parliament Unicameral

BUCHAREST (Romania), September 24 (SeeNews) – Romanian President Traian Basescu called on Thursday for a referendum to be held on downsizing the country’s parliament to a single chamber with 300 seats in a bid to tame corruption.

Romania's bicameral parliament now has a total of 471 deputies.

"A unicameral parliament means that decisions will be taken easier and the legislature will become more efficient," the presidential press office quoted Basescu as saying in a press statement.

At the same time, the measure will allow to cut costs and reduce corruption as there will be fewer high-level politicians involved in abuse of power, Basescu added in the statement.

Basescu proposed to combine the referendum with the upcoming presidential elections in Romania on November 22.
